Video: Cum funcționează migrarea laravel?
2024 Autor: Lynn Donovan | [email protected]. Modificat ultima dată: 2023-12-15 23:52
3 Răspunsuri. Migrații sunt un tip de control al versiunilor pentru baza de date. Acestea permit unei echipe să modifice schema bazei de date și să rămână la curent cu starea curentă a schemei. Migrații sunt de obicei asociate cu Schema Builder pentru a gestiona cu ușurință schema aplicației dvs.
Prin urmare, la ce folosește migrația în laravel?
Pur și simplu pune, Migrația Laravel este o modalitate care vă permite să creați un tabel în baza de date, fără a merge efectiv la managerul bazei de date, cum ar fi phpmyadmin sau sql lite sau oricare ar fi managerul dumneavoastră.
În al doilea rând, cum migrez în laravel? La crea A migrație , folosește face : migrație Comandă artizanală: Când tu crea A migrație fişier, Laravel îl stochează în directorul /database/migrations. Fiecare migrație numele fișierului conține un marcaj de timp care permite Laravel pentru a determina ordinea migraţiilor.
În acest fel, ce este migrația în laravel?
Artizan și Laravel Migrații. Pe scurt, migrațiile sunt fișiere care conțin o definiție de clasă atât cu o metodă up() cât și cu una down(). Metoda up() este rulată atunci când migrație este executat pentru a aplica modificări la baza de date. Metoda down() este rulată pentru a anula modificările.
Cum derulez înapoi o anumită migrare în laravel?
Modificați numărul de lot al migrație doriți să rollback la cel mai înalt. Alerga migra : rollback.
- Accesați DB și ștergeți/redenumiți intrarea de migrare pentru migrarea dvs. specifică.
- Aruncă tabelul creat de migrarea specifică.
- Rulați php artisan migrate --path=/database/migrations/your-specific-migration. php.
Recomandat:
De ce este necesară migrarea datelor?
Migrarea datelor este importantă deoarece este o componentă necesară pentru actualizarea sau consolidarea serverului și a hardware-ului de stocare, sau pentru adăugarea de aplicații care consumă intens date precum baze de date, depozite de date și lacuri de date și proiecte de virtualizare la scară largă
Ce este migrarea în etape la Office 365?
Migrarea în etape este procesul care are loc ca proces de implementare a Office 365. Acest proces are loc în timp și migrează cutiile poștale Exchange la Office 365
Cum testați migrarea?
Ce este testarea migrației? Testarea migrației este un proces de verificare a migrării sistemului moștenit la noul sistem cu întreruperi/perioade minime de nefuncționare, cu integritate a datelor și fără pierderi de date, asigurând în același timp că toate aspectele funcționale și nefuncționale specificate ale aplicației sunt îndeplinite post- migrație
Cum scap de migrarea EF?
Eliminați o migrare Uneori adăugați o migrare și realizați că trebuie să faceți modificări suplimentare modelului dvs. EF Core înainte de a o aplica. Pentru a elimina ultima migrare, utilizați această comandă. După ce eliminați migrarea, puteți face modificări suplimentare de model și îl puteți adăuga din nou
Cum derulez înapoi migrarea în Entity Framework Core?
Pentru a anula ultima migrare aplicată, ar trebui să (comenzile consolei managerului de pachete): Reveniți migrarea din baza de date: PM> Actualizare-Bază de date Eliminați fișierul de migrare din proiect (sau va fi reaplicat la pasul următor) Actualizați instantaneul modelului: PM> Eliminați-Migrare